Quotes by Mary Baker Eddy

“Happiness is spiritual, born of truth and love. It is unselfish therefore it cannot exist alone, but requires all mankind to share it.”

“I would no more quarrel with a man because of his religion than I would because of his art.”

“Sin brought death, and death will disappear with the disappearance of sin.”

“Disease is an experience of a so-called mortal mind. It is fear made manifest on the body.”

“Experience teaches us that we do not always receive the blessings we ask for in prayer.”

“Health is not a condition of matter, but of Mind.”

“Jealousy is the grave of affection.”

“If Christianity is not scientific, and Science is not God, then there is no invariable law, and truth becomes an accident.”

“Chastity is the cement of civilization and progress. Without it there is no stability in society, and without it one cannot attain the Science of Life.”
